Context: Over 60 drown in a migrant vessel off Libya while trying to reach Europe
More about the news:
- A boat carrying 86 migrants capsized off the coast of Libya, resulting in the tragic death of over 60 people, including women and children.
- The incident occurred near the town of Zuwara on Libya’s western coast, with strong waves causing the boat to capsize.
- The UN’s International Organization for Migration (IOM) reported the shipwreck, emphasizing the perilous nature of the central Mediterranean route, one of the world’s most dangerous migration paths.
- Libya has become a major transit point for migrants fleeing conflict and poverty in Africa and the Middle East, and the central Mediterranean is a deadly route for those seeking entry into Europe.
- The region has witnessed thousands of deaths, with over 2,250 fatalities reported on this route in the current year alone.
Some facts about International Organization for Migration (IOM)
- IOM is an intergovernmental organization that provides services and advice concerning migration to governments and migrants, including refugees, internally displaced persons and migrant workers.
- IOM was established in 1951 as Inter governmental Committee for European Migration (ICEM) to help resettle people displaced by World War II.
- It was granted Permanent Observer status to the UN General Assembly in 1992.
- Cooperation agreement between IOM and the UN was signed in 1996.
- The World Migration Report is published every year by the International Organization for Migration (IOM) of the UN.
- IOM works in four broad areas of migration management:
- Migration and development,
- Facilitating migration,
- Regulating migration and
- Forced migration.
- It has175 member states, a further 8 states holding observer status and offices in over 100 countries.
- India is a member of IOM.
Some facts about Libya:
- Libya is a country in the Maghreb region of North Africa.
- It borders the Mediterranean Sea to the north, Egypt to the east, Sudan to the southeast, Chad to the south, Niger to the southwest, Algeria to the west, and Tunisia to the northwest.
- Tripoli is the capital of Libya.
- Libya had the largest proven crude oil reserves in Africa
